Digital payments

Digital payments

- [Narrator] Digital payments, also known as electronic payments or e-payments, refers to transactions in which money is exchanged electronically without the use of physical cash or checks. These transactions evolve the transfer of funds from one party to another through various digital channels and platforms. Mobile wallets like Apple Pay, Google Pay, or Samsung Pay are methods of digital payments. Digital payments services allow customers to link their credit or debit cards to their smartphones and make countless payments at physical stores or online. Digital payments are becoming more popular and widespread has more people and businesses adapt them. They are changing the way we shop, bank, and interact with each other.
